Detailed Comparison

MetricBoat and ship builders and repairersSheet metal workersDifference
Median Annual£31,298£32,915-£1,617
Mean Annual£31,830£35,352-£3,522
Monthly£2,608£2,743-£135
Weekly£602£633-£31
Hourly£15.05£15.82-£0.77
